    MFS CLOSED-END FUNDS ANNOUNCE SPECIAL SHAREHOLDER MEETINGS RELATING TO PROPOSED
    REORGANIZATIONS AND PROPOSED APPOINTMENT OF ABERDEEN

    INVESTMENTS AS INVESTMENT ADVISER

     

    BOSTON (December 11, 2025) – MFS Investment Management (“MFS”) announced today that the Board of Trustees (the “Board”) of MFS Charter Income Trust (NYSE: MCR), MFS Government Markets Income Trust (NYSE: MGF), MFS Intermediate High Income Fund (NYSE: CIF), and MFS Intermediate Income Trust (NYSE: MIN) (each a “Target Fund” and collectively, the “Target Funds”) approved the proposed reorganization of each Target Fund into the MFS Multimarket Income Trust (NYSE: MMT) (the “Surviving Fund”) (each a “Reorganization” and collectively, the “Reorganizations”). The Board has also approved three related proposals for the Surviving Fund: i) the appointment of Aberdeen Investments, the global specialist asset manager, as the new investment adviser, ii) the appointment of five new trustees, and iii) the issuance of additional common shares in connection with the proposed Reorganizations. Each of the three proposals is subject to approval by the Surviving Fund’s shareholders, the consummation of certain of the proposed Reorganizations and certain other conditions.

     

    Subject to the aforementioned approvals, upon closing it is intended that the Surviving Fund name would be changed from “MFS Multimarket Income Trust” to “Aberdeen Multi-Market Income Fund”.

     

    The Reorganizations

     

    Each Reorganization is subject to the receipt of necessary shareholder approval by the respective Target Fund, as discussed further below.

    The Reorganizations are intended to increase the scale, liquidity and marketability of the Target Funds and the Surviving Fund, which may help reduce the discount to net asset value per share over time. The Reorganizations will allow shareholders of each Target Fund and the Surviving Fund to continue their investment in a significantly larger fund with the potential for a higher annual distribution rate. Each Target Fund and the Surviving Fund have similar investment objectives and investment policies. Each Target Fund’s Board believes that the Reorganization is in the best interest of the applicable Target Fund’s shareholders.

     

    Required Approval of Each Target Fund’s Shareholders

     

    Shareholders of each Target Fund as of December 11, 2025, will be asked to approve their respective Reorganization at a special meeting of shareholders of each Target Fund, tentatively scheduled for March 11, 2026. Shareholders of each Target Fund will receive a prospectus/proxy statement (the “Target Funds Prospectus/Proxy Statement”) providing additional information and soliciting a vote in favor of the respective Target Fund’s Reorganization. Each Target Fund’s Board has determined that the Reorganization of that Target Fund into the Surviving Fund is in the best interests of the Target Fund’s shareholders and recommends shareholders vote in favor of their Target Fund’s Reorganization. If approved, the Reorganizations are expected to consummate in the second quarter of 2026.

     

    Issuance of Shares by the Surviving Fund

     

    Shareholders of the Surviving Fund will be asked to approve the issuance of additional common shares (the “Reorganization Shares”) to accommodate the Reorganizations. With the exception of the Reorganization of MFS Intermediate High Income Fund, each Reorganization is contingent upon shareholder approval of the issuance of the Reorganization Shares.

     

    Appointment of Aberdeen Investments as Investment Adviser and the Election of New Trustees for the Surviving Fund

     

    In addition to and in connection with the Reorganizations, the Board of the Surviving Fund has approved (i) a new investment management agreement with the US Subsidiary of Aberdeen Investments, abrdn Inc., to serve as the investment adviser to the Surviving Fund following the consummation of the Reorganizations and (ii) the nomination of five new trustees to serve as the Surviving Fund’s board of trustees following the consummation of the Reorganizations. The appointment of abrdn Inc. as the Surviving Fund’s investment adviser and the election of the five new trustees as the Surviving Fund’s board of trustees are subject to the approval of the Surviving Fund’s shareholders and certain contingencies, as discussed further below.

     

    About Aberdeen Investments

     

    In the United States, Aberdeen Investments is the marketing name for the following affiliated, registered investment advisers: abrdn Inc., abrdn Investments Limited and abrdn Asia Limited.

     

    Aberdeen Investments constitutes one of the world’s largest asset management firms with extensive experience in managing closed-end funds dating back to the 1980s. As of September 30, 2025, Aberdeen Investments had approximately $515 billion in assets under management. Moreover, closed-end funds are an important element of Aberdeen Investments’ client base in the U.S. and globally, managing 15

     

     

     

     

    U.S. closed-end funds and 13 non-U.S. closed-end funds, totaling $26.1 billion in assets as of September 30, 2025.

     

    Required Vote of the Surviving Fund’s Shareholders

     

    Shareholders of the Surviving Fund as of December 11, 2025, will be asked to approve the new investment management agreement appointing abrdn Inc. as its new investment adviser and to elect the five new trustees for the Surviving Fund at a special meeting of shareholders, tentatively scheduled for March 11, 2026. Shareholders of the Surviving Fund will receive a proxy statement (the “Surviving Fund Proxy Statement”) providing additional information and soliciting a vote in favor of each proposal, both of which are recommended by the Surviving Fund’s Board. If approved, it is expected that the appointment of abrdn Inc. as investment adviser and the election of the five new Trustees will take effect upon the consummation of the Reorganizations, which is expected to occur in the second quarter of 2026.

     

    The Surviving Fund’s Board believes that each proposal described above is in the best interests of the Surviving Fund’s shareholders and recommends that shareholders of the Surviving Fund vote in favor of each proposal.

     

    Further information concerning the above will be provided in the Target Funds Prospectus/Proxy Statement and the Surviving Fund Proxy Statement which will be mailed to shareholders of the Target Funds and Surviving Fund, respectively.

     

    Filing and Mailing of Shareholder Materials

     

    The Target Funds Proxy Statement and the Surviving Fund Proxy Statement have yet to be filed with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(the “SEC”). After filing with the SEC, the Target Funds Prospectus/Proxy Statement and Surviving Fund Proxy Statement may be amended or withdrawn. The Target Funds Prospectus/Proxy Statement and Surviving Fund Proxy Statement are expected to be mailed to shareholders of record on December 11, 2025, of each Target Fund and the Surviving Fund, as applicable, in late January 2026.

    About the Funds

     

    The funds are closed-end investment company products advised by MFS Investment Management. Closed-end funds, unlike open-end funds, are not continuously offered. There is a one-time public offering and once issued, common shares of the funds are bought and sold in the open market through

     

     

     

     

    a stock exchange. Shares may trade at a discount to the net asset value per share. Shares of the funds are not FDIC-insured and are not deposits or other obligations of, or guaranteed by, any bank. Shares of the funds involve investment risk, including possible loss of principal.
